Executive Director
Betty M. Ruth
Executive Director - Betty Muse Ruth has been the director since October 13, 1978. She holds a Bachelor's Degree from Athens State University in Business Administration and Master's in Business Administration from the University of North Alabama.
Betty is currently serving as treasurer of the National Association of RSVP Directors. She has served on the national board in various positions including President and Vice President. In addition she is currently serving as President of the Southern States Association and served in various positions on the Alabama Association of RSVP Directors. Betty was appointed by Governor Bob Riley to the Alabama Department of Senior Services Board of Directors for a four year term. She was appointed to the Governor's Commission on Faith-Based and Community Initiatives in 1993 and is currently serving as Co-Chair of the Commission. She served three terms as chair of the Commission. The Governor of Alabama appointed Betty as a Delegate to the White House Conference on Aging in 1996. Betty served as a delegate to the 2005 White House Conference on Aging. She was appointed by Congressman Bud Cramer. Betty serves on the Athens State University Alumni Board of Directors and chairs the Alumni Awards Committee.

Reading Coordinator
Barbara G. McMeans
Donald G. McMeans and Barbara Gordon were married April 23, 1954. They have three children Don, Bobbie Jayne, and Sonya Faye; four grandchildren, Beth, Kurt, Ethan, Trey and John Michael.
Barbara retired from Athens City Board of Education (Cowart Elementary School) fourteen years ago. For the next five years, she was a full time grandmother. Then she opened a Day Care for Children for six year before retiring again.
Out of retirement once more, in June 2000, Barbara became the Reading Coordinator for RSVP. She works with the Athens and Limestone County Elementary Schools. The volunteers work one on one with students to improve reading skills. It is a joy to see the smiles on the children’s faces as they improve their reading skills. The critical years are kindergarten to third grades. It is important to reach these children at an early age. |
